Thanks fellas! I just put my whole hand and wrist behind the bumper (it has a fair bit of flex in it). The clips on the bottom have to be released upwards so they're almost impossible to get to from between the slats, for my fingers anyway. One suggestion which may sound obvious though, is to just tackle the clips one by one in a circular manner going around the grille. Each one gets progressivily easier.
